Van Russell is a county judge of the Franklin County Court of Florida. His current term expired on January 8, 2019.

Education

Russell received his B.A. degree from Emory University and his J.D. degree from Florida State University. He was admitted to the Bar 1979.[1]

2012 election

Russell was unopposed and automatically re-elected following the Nov. 6, 2012 general election.[2][3]
